Solution for 18=3y-y equation:


Simplifying
18 = 3y + -1y

Combine like terms: 3y + -1y = 2y
18 = 2y

Solving
18 = 2y

Solving for variable 'y'.

Move all terms containing y to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-2y' to each side of the equation.
18 + -2y = 2y + -2y

Combine like terms: 2y + -2y = 0
18 + -2y = 0

Add '-18' to each side of the equation.
18 + -18 + -2y = 0 + -18

Combine like terms: 18 + -18 = 0
0 + -2y = 0 + -18
-2y = 0 + -18

Combine like terms: 0 + -18 = -18
-2y = -18

Divide each side by '-2'.
y = 9

Simplifying
y = 9
